They replied to me about 2 weeks after I replied to their advert on eslcafe board, apologising for the delay - their system crashed or something. There was a lengthy 2 part questionnaire attached. Before going ahead and completing it I asked them if they only accepted American/Canadian native speakers. The answer was yes, so that was the end of that for me but she was very nice and polite about it. Glad I didn't do the application form though! She did mention that they were recruiting for a position to start end of March and 2 in July - that was last month. |
